Digital publishing provides the opportunity to unlock new revenue streams that are currently difficult to exploit with traditional publishing. Many publishing companies in the US and Europe are now increasing their revenues and productivity by adopting successful new digital publishing strategies.


Obtain insights at this event about:

- traditional versus digital publishing - the latest trends in the US and Europe

- how additional revenues can be obtained with digital publishing, with examples of successful business models in the US and Europe

- the relative importance of channel players such as Amazon, Google and Apple, and how these vary by region

- what's next for the market in Singapore - we will open up for discussion and the sharing of ideas and experience of attendees at this event

Facilitated by Sondre Bjornebekk, founder of TapBookAuthor who has successfully helped print publishers in Europe generate new revenues by making existing content digital, and enriching it.
